System Mechanics

The standard control scheme utilizes directional inputs or a pointing device to navigate environments and interact with objects. Primary objectives revolve around resource collection, habitat expansion, and satisfying creature needs to ensure survival. Common mechanics include feeding cycles, grooming tasks, and spatial navigation to avoid environmental hazards. These systems function without narrative constraints, focusing entirely on procedural interaction loops.
